Reading

Please ensure that your child reads daily. It is expected that children are heard to read at home for at least 10-15 minutes a day. They should be reading a variety of fiction and non-fiction books. It is important that they read to an adult/older sibling as often as possible. Please encourage your child to ask and to answer questions about their book and encourage them to give opinions about the book. Reading diaries must be signed by an adult each time they read at home.

Spellings

Each week, as a part of their home learning, children will be expected to learn a set of spellings which they will be quizzed on Friday of the following week. These spellings are based on the Year Three and Four National Curriculum spelling list. Children should be encouraged to look for and learn spelling patterns in these words and other words. Please practise these regularly at home. It is more beneficial to work on spellings in short bursts; 5-10 minutes every day, rather than longer sessions. It is also very helpful to encourage your child to learn the meanings of these words (and other unfamiliar words) as well as helping them to develop their ability to apply these in context by writing a few sentences.
